테스트 사이트 - 개발 중인 베타 버전입니다

글쓰기 버튼 무조건 보이기

· 14년 전 · 3896 · 6
저 같은 경우는 글쓰기 권한 2 인 회원게시판이 있는데
 
원래는 비회원은 글쓰기 버튼이 안보이죠
 
아래처럼 수정했습니다.
 
bbs/list.php
 
하래 부분에 이 항목이 있습니다. 원래는
 
$write_href = "";
if ($member[mb_level] >= $board[bo_write_level])
    $write_href = "./write.php?bo_table=$bo_table";
 
이렇게 되어 있습니다.
즉 글쓰기 권한보다 높으면(회원포함) 글쓰기 버튼을 보여라 이 말이죠
 
그래서 권한 하고 상관없이 항상 보이게 하라
 
$write_href = "";
if ($member[mb_level] = $board[bo_write_level])
    $write_href = "./write.php?bo_table=$bo_table";
 
저는 이렇게 수정했습니다 ^^ 참고 하세요~

댓글 작성

댓글을 작성하시려면 로그인이 필요합니다.

로그인하기

댓글 6개

14년 전
감사합니다. 저에게 아주 좋은 팁이네요 ^^
if ($member[mb_level] = $board[bo_write_level])
이건 문법 자체가 틀렸습니다
비교구문은 == (등호 2개)를 사용합니다

직접 소스를 수정 하는 것이 아니라 게시판 관리에서 쓰기 권한을 1로 하면 됩니다
14년 전
비회원 게시판은 1로 해서 아무나 쓰게 해도 되겠지만
회원제 게시판 일땐 비회원도 버튼 누르고 로그인이나 회원가입으로 가야할 길을
만들어주는거죠 버튼 자체가 없으니까요
해당스킨의 list.skin 의 수정법도 있으나 전 이 방법을 팁으로 올려드린거에요 ~^^
14년 전
위처럼 하면 올바른게 아니죠.

$write_href = "";
//if ($member[mb_level] >= $board[bo_write_level])
$write_href = "./write.php?bo_table=$bo_table";
무조건 보이게하는건 그냥 $write_href = "./write.php?bo_table=$bo_table";
이렇게 스면 되는데....ㅋㅋㅋ
자료 감사합니다.^^
잘 쓰겠습니다.

게시글 목록

번호 제목
34021
33994
33922
33895
33889
33882
33868
33863
33859
33857
33849
33842
33835
33830
33828
33807
33797
33796
33791
33786